@charset "utf-8";

@import url("../../_styles/layout.css"); 

/* CSS Document */
#content {clear:both; line-height:1.5em;}

.wid_95 {width:80px !important;}
.wid_140 {width:100px !important;}

.wid_84 {width:84px !important;}

.wid_132 {width:132px !important;}
.wid_264 {width:264px !important;}
.wid_396 {width:396px !important;}
.wid_528 {width:528px !important;}



.padMT4 {margin-top:4px;}
.textAlignLeft {text-align:left !important;}
.tab {border-bottom:solid 1px #5e5e5e;float:left; width:100%; }
.tab ul{float:right; _margin-bottom:-1px; }
.tab ul li{float:left; margin-left:-1px; text-align:center; font-size:0.9em;}

.tab ul li a:link, .tab ul li a:visited  {display:block; float:left; width:70px; position:relative; z-index:248; height:16px; padding:4px 8px 3px 8px;  _padding:4px 8px 3px 8px; color:#666; background:#f6f6f6; border:solid 1px #d8d8d8; margin-bottom:-1px !important; border-bottom:solid 1px #5e5e5e;}

.tab ul li a:hover, .tab ul li a:active, .tab ul li a.current:link, .tab ul li a.current:visited , .tab ul li a.current:hover,.tab ul li a.current:active   { display:block; float:left;  width:70px; position:relative; z-index:258; height:18px; _height:21px; padding:6px 8px 4px 8px; _padding:6px 8px 3px 8px; color:#000; background:#fcfcfc; font-weight:bold; border:solid 1px #5e5e5e;  border-bottom:solid 1px #fff; margin-bottom:-1px; margin-top:-5px !important;} 



table {clear:both;}
table th.firstChild, table td.firstChild {border-left:none !important;}
table th.lastChild, table td.lastChild {border-right:none !important;}


.basicCenterTable {width:100%;  font-size:0.98em; border-top:solid 2px #5e5e5e; border-bottom:solid 2px #d0d0d0;}
.basicCenterTable  th.firstChild  {width:80px;}
.basicCenterTable thead th {background:#eee; border: solid 1px #c6c6c6; padding:4px 4px 3px 4px; color:#333;}
.basicCenterTable tbody th {background:#f8f8f8; border: solid 1px #c6c6c6; padding:2px 4px; font-weight:normal; color:#555; font-family:Verdana; font-size:0.9em;}
.basicCenterTable tbody td {background:#fff; border: solid 1px #d0d0d0; padding:0 10px 0 10px;  vertical-align:top; height:100%; float:left; text-align:center;}
.basicCenterTable tbody td.textAlignLeft {text-align:left !important;}

.basicCenterTable thead tr.hide {padding:0 !important; margin:0  !important; height:0.1%  !important;}
.basicCenterTable thead tr.hide th{padding:0 !important; margin:0 !important; height:0.1% !important;}
.basicCenterTable thead tr.hide td{padding:0 !important; margin:0 !important; height:0.1% !important;}

.basicCenterTable tbody td ul {display:inline;}
.basicCenterTable tbody td ul li{float:left; display:inline; border-right:solid 1px #ccc; height:50px;}



/* 
.basicCenterTable thead th {width:9% !important;}
.basicCenterTable thead th+th {width:52% !important;}
.basicCenterTable tbody th {width:9% !important;}
.basicCenterTable tbody th+td {width:20%; word-break:break-all; }
.basicCenterTable tbody th+td+td {width:20%;  word-break:break-all;}
.basicCenterTable tbody th+td+td+td {width:20%;  word-break:break-all;}
.basicCenterTable tbody th+td+td+td+td {width:20%;  word-break:break-all;} */



.track {display:block; padding:3px 0 0 0; color:#353535; /*border-bottom:solid 1px #ccc;*/ }
.time {color:#777; }
.trackTitle {margin:1px 0  0  0; color:#ff7f21; line-height:1.3em; cursor:hand; padding-bottom:5px;} 
.pannel {margin:0 0 3px 0; color:#079eb4; cursor:hand; /* border-top:solid 1px #ccc;*/}



/*.wid_174 {width:174px; border-right:solid 1px #ccc; height:100%;}*/
